Add Animations to Your Website with AI Tools: Step-by-Step Guide

steve jacobsteve jacob
4 min read

In today’s digital landscape, websites need more than just functionality—they need flair. Animation plays a key role in engaging users, directing their attention, and enhancing the overall user experience. But creating sleek, responsive animations from scratch can be time-consuming and technically demanding.

That’s where AI tools come in.

Thanks to advancements in artificial intelligence, even beginners can now add interactive, eye-catching animations to their websites—without writing complex code or spending hours in animation software.

In this step-by-step guide, we’ll show you exactly how to add animations to your website using AI-powered tools, so you can modernize your online presence with ease.

Why Use AI Tools for Website Animation?

Before jumping into the how-to, let’s briefly look at the benefits of using AI tools for animations:

  • No coding required – Create animations visually, with little or no coding skills.

  • Faster development – Save time by automating repetitive animation tasks.

  • Custom recommendations – AI tools can analyze your site and suggest animations that fit your content and layout.

  • Better performance – Many tools optimize the animations for speed and responsiveness.

  • Cross-browser compatibility – AI-generated animations typically follow best practices to work across all modern browsers.

Here are some leading AI-powered platforms that help you design and implement animations:

Tool Name

Features

Ideal For

LottieFiles

Converts Adobe After Effects animations into lightweight JSON animations

Web and app animations

Spline

Create and export interactive 3D web elements

3D and interactive design

Designs.ai

AI-powered animation and video creation platform

Marketing visuals and banners

Animaker

Drag-and-drop video and animation creator with templates

Animated content and intros

Runway ML

AI video editor for motion tracking, background removal, and more

Advanced motion effects and video

Haiku Animator

Code-friendly animation tool for developers with AI suggestions

UI/UX prototyping

Step-by-Step Guide to Add Animations with AI Tools

Step 1: Choose the Right AI Animation Tool

Start by identifying your animation needs:

  • Want to animate buttons or UI elements? Try LottieFiles.

  • Need full-page scroll animations or transitions? Go with Spline or Haiku Animator.

  • Interested in animated intros or banners? Use Animaker or Designs.ai.

For this tutorial, let’s walk through how to use LottieFiles to add lightweight, scalable animations.

Step 2: Create or Select a Lottie Animation

  1. Visit https://lottiefiles.com

  2. Sign up for a free account.

  3. Browse the Lottie Library for ready-to-use animations.

  4. Filter by category or search (e.g., “loading spinner”, “success checkmark”, etc.)

  5. Once you find the animation you like, click "Download JSON".

Bonus: You can also customize the animation’s color and speed directly on LottieFiles.

Step 3: Embed the Animation on Your Website

  1. Upload your downloaded .json file to your web server or hosting.

  2. Use the Lottie Web Player or HTML Embed Code to display it.

Here’s a sample HTML code snippet:

<script src="https://unpkg.com/lottie-web@latest/build/player/lottie.min.js"></script>

<div id="animationContainer" style="width:300px; height:300px;"></div>

<script>

lottie.loadAnimation({

container: document.getElementById('animationContainer'),

renderer: 'svg',

loop: true,

autoplay: true,

path: 'path-to-your-animation.json'

});

</script>

Replace 'path-to-your-animation.json' with the actual URL or path to your file.

Step 4: Make It Responsive and Optimize

  • Use CSS media queries to scale the animation container on different screen sizes.

  • Reduce file size by compressing your Lottie file (LottieFiles offers optimization tools).

  • Lazy load animations to improve page speed, especially on mobile devices.

Example:

<iframe loading="lazy" src="your-lottie-url" width="100%" height="auto"></iframe>

Advanced Tip: Use AI to Suggest Animation Placements

Some AI-powered platforms like Durable.co and Framer AI offer full website design generation, including intelligent placement of animations for better user flow. These tools analyze your site layout and can automatically apply animation presets where needed (like buttons, scroll reveals, modals, etc.).

Best Practices for Using Website Animations

While animations can boost user experience, too much of it can overwhelm. Here are a few pro tips:

  • Keep animations subtle and purposeful.

  • Avoid auto-playing sound or motion without user interaction.

  • Test across devices for performance and responsiveness.

  • Use animations to enhance UX, not distract from it.

  • Use AI tools that let you preview or simulate real user behavior.

Real-World Example: AI + Animation = Better UX

A SaaS company increased its form conversion rate by 23% after replacing a static "Submit" button with a Lottie animation that added a bounce effect on hover and a confetti animation on success.

The animation was powered by LottieFiles and implemented with zero lines of custom JavaScript—just HTML and CSS.

Final Thoughts

Adding animations to your website no longer requires advanced programming or design skills. Thanks to AI tools, web animations are now more accessible, customizable, and optimized than ever.

Whether you're building a portfolio, e-commerce store, or business landing page, these tools allow you to create stunning visual interactions in just a few clicks.

Start exploring AI animation tools today—and transform your website into an engaging digital experience.

0
Subscribe to my newsletter

Read articles from steve jacob directly inside your inbox. Subscribe to the newsletter, and don't miss out.

Written by

steve jacob
steve jacob